This elegant 4-bedroom, 4-bathroom detached home is available for lease in the sought-after Credit Valley community. Featuring a brick exterior, private entrance, attached 2-car garage, and 3 total parking spaces, this home offers comfort and convenience. The main floor includes a bright family room with hardwood flooring, fireplace, and open-concept layout, along with a spacious combined living and dining area featuring pot lights and large windows. The kitchen is designed with gran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, and a pantry. Upstairs, the primary bedroom offers broadloom flooring and a walk-in closet, while the additional bedrooms include closets and practical layouts. This unfurnished home includes ensuite laundry, central air conditioning, forced air gas heating, and is close to parks, public transit, schools, and school bus routes. A great lease opportunity in the heart of Credit Valley.

Things to Confirm Before Signing
· Are utilities included, or separate?
· How many parking spots are included?
· Is the landlord open to a 1-year or 2-year lease?
· Are pets and small renovations (paint, hooks) allowed?
· When was the last rent increase, if there is a prior tenant?
Utility estimates are approximate and vary by season, habits, and what the landlord includes. Always confirm inclusions with the listing agent.
